NCT ID: NCT03063177 Completed - Back Pain Clinical Trials

Evaluation of How Different Dosages of Spinal Manipulation Modulate Spinal Stiffness in Participants With Back Pain

Start date: May 1, 2017
Phase: N/A
Study type: Interventional

This study evaluate the relationships between spinal manipulative therapy dosage (speed and peak force), the resulting modulation of thoracic spinal stiffness and changes in the clinical status in participants with chronic thoracic pain. Participants will attend four sessions of one hour over 2 weeks. During session 1 to 3, participants will receive one of three different spinal manipulative therapy dosages based on their group assignment and preceded and followed by the measurement of their thoracic spinal stiffness. Session 4 will include spinal stiffness measurement and clinical status evaluation through questionnaires.

NCT ID: NCT03061903 Completed - Wound Complication Clinical Trials

Closed Incision Negative Pressure Therapy vs Standard of Care

Prevena
Start date: May 14, 2018
Phase: N/A
Study type: Interventional

High risk patients who receive direct anterior approach total hip arthroplasty are more likely to experience wound complications. The purpose of this study is to determine whether the usage of closed incision negative pressure dressings decreases the risk of wound complication compared to standard dressings. Patients who decide to participate in the study will be randomized to one of the two dressing prior to surgery and will leave the operating room with one of the treating dressings. Patient will be monitored 90 days after surgery for wound complications and pictures of the wounds will be taken. The patients course of treatment besides being randomized to one of the two dressings will be identical to any other patient received a Direct Anterior Approach for Total Hip Arthroplasty (DAA THA). The primary outcome measure will be uneventful wound healing (requiring no intervention) versus the occurrence of wound complications (wound drainage, breakdown, necrosis, dehiscence, superficial or deep infection) requiring additional intervention. Intervention will be defined as any attempt of the surgeon to improve wound healing (in-office debridement, topical ointment, aspiration, antibiotic therapy, or return to the OR for the wound). Secondary outcome measures will include duration of wound healing delay, length of hospital stay, number of days of antibiotic therapy, and direct and estimated indirect costs.

NCT ID: NCT03061578 Completed - Dry Eye Clinical Trials

Evaluation of Dry Eye by Tear Film Imager in a Low Humidity Environmental Exposure Chamber (TFI-LH16)

TFI-LH16
Start date: January 26, 2017
Phase: N/A
Study type: Observational

The study consists of 3 study visits to the clinic over at least 9 days. Visit 1 - the medical screening visit: subjects will undergo informed consent and will be tested for signs and symptoms of Dry Eye Syndrome (DES) including measurements by the TFI. Upon conclusion of the screening for DES, the subjects will be divided to the different categories: NDE, LDDE and ADDE. For ADDE and LDDE subjects the eye fitting the worst DES inclusion criteria will be designated as the study eye. For the NDE subjects the best eye will be designated as the study eye. During Visit 2 and 3, the TFI measurement and other clinical study endpoint procedures will be only conducted on the study eye. The safety endpoint procedures will still be conducted on both eyes individually throughout the study. Subjects will be queried for adverse events (AEs) at all visits. Visit 2 - after two days washout period subject will return for the LH-EEC test. Signs and symptoms of dry eye will be recorded before entering the LH-EEC, during the 120 min stay in the LH-EEC and at the conclusion of the day. Visit 3 - after 7 days washout period subject will return for the last test. The third day procedure is identical to the second day, with the addition of: following LH-EEC exit, subjects will have a health check and study check out procedures conducted. Statistical Analysis: Data will be summarized with respect to baseline characteristics, efficacy variables and safety variables. Summary statistics will include the number of observations (N), mean, standard deviation (SD), median, minimum and maximum values for continuous variables and frequencies and percentages for categorical variables. Missing values will not be replaced or imputed, i.e., no interpolation or extrapolation will be applied to missing values. Safety data will be listed and summarized by group (NDE, ADDE, and LDDE).
